John Wilkes Booth’s derringer pistol used to kill President Abraham Lincoln is displayed at a new exhibit entitled “Silent Witnesses: Artifacts of the Lincoln Assassination” at the Ford’s Center for Education and Leadership across the street from the historic Ford’s Theatre on Tuesday, March 17, 2015 in Washington. The exhibit is open to the public March 23rd to May 25th and coincides with the 150th anniversary of the Lincoln assassination on April 14th. (AP Photo/Andrew Harnik)
Protestors hold up signs during a rally against a contentious “religious freedom” bill, Tuesday, March 17, 2015, in Atlanta. The Georgia Senate gave decisive approval to the bill, one of a wave of measures surfacing in at least a dozen states that critics say could provide legal cover for discrimination against gays and transgender people. Photographs of Serbs missing and killed during the 1998-99 war in Kosovo are seen in front of Serbia’s war crimes court in Belgrade, Serbia, Tuesday, March 17, 2015. Tuesday marks the 11th anniversary of an attack on minority Serbs by Kosovo extremists that sent thousands fleeing their homes. (AP Photo/Darko Vojinovic)
